<p dir="auto">Similar show with a similar concept. Sliders was about dimension travel to various other dimensions that were all alternate, divergent parallel universes, where on the Planet Earth, something had happened that couldn't, shouldn't or wouldn't have happened but, for some reason, still did. That is only one aspect of the Fantastic Journey, as the travelers didn't just dimension travel to various other dimensions, they also traveled to various other spaces and times, too. Similar to Doctor Who. The series Sliders itself was an okay show but it eventually became a failure in science-fiction, often ultimately becoming a cliche with the writing.
